Задать вопрос
@tolorov

Как остановить выполнение функции в зависимости от высоты экрана (параллакс и вьюпорт)?

Есть функция выполняющая следующее:
var scrollPosition = window.scrollY
this.parallaxed = scrollPosition / 1.02


Как остановить выполнение в зависимости от размеров экрана? Например, есть значение document.body.scrollHeightю Как зная это значение остановить этот процесс?
if (document.body.scrollHeight блаблабла, не выше этого значения) {
 var scrollPosition = window.scrollY
 this.parallaxed = scrollPosition / 1.02
}
  • Вопрос задан
  • 129 просмотров
Подписаться 1 Оценить 9 комментариев
Помогут разобраться в теме Все курсы
  • Яндекс Практикум
    Фронтенд-разработчик
    10 месяцев
    Далее
  • Skillbox
    JavaScript
    3 месяца
    Далее
  • Нетология
    Fullstack-разработчик на Python + нейросети
    20 месяцев
    Далее
Пригласить эксперта
Ответы на вопрос 1
@tolorov Автор вопроса
Офигеть, как все просто. Мне помог гребанный position: fixed

УЧИТЕ CSS, ЛЮДИ!!!
Ответ написан
Комментировать
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ы